AI Engineer Salary Guide 2026

Complete salary guide for AI engineers in 2026. Covers all levels from entry to staff, across different locations and specializations.

Understanding AI engineer compensation is essential whether you are negotiating an offer, planning a career move, or benchmarking your current salary. This guide covers 2026 salary ranges across experience levels, locations, and specializations.

AI Engineer Salary by Experience Level

Entry Level (0 to 2 years): $100K to $160K

New graduates and early-career AI engineers can expect base salaries between $100K and $160K, depending on location, education, and company. Top tech companies in the Bay Area and NYC offer the higher end of this range.

Total compensation (including signing bonus and equity): $120K to $200K

Mid Level (2 to 5 years): $150K to $250K

With a few years of experience, AI engineers see significant salary jumps. Mid-level professionals who can independently design and ship ML systems are in high demand.

Total compensation: $180K to $350K

Senior Level (5 to 8 years): $200K to $350K

Senior AI engineers lead projects, mentor teams, and make architectural decisions. They are expected to work with ambiguity and drive technical direction.

Total compensation: $300K to $500K

Staff/Principal (8+ years): $280K to $450K

Staff and Principal level engineers set technical vision across organizations, solve the hardest problems, and have outsized impact on company direction.

Total compensation: $400K to $800K+

Salary by Location

United States

CityMid-Level BaseSenior Base
San Francisco$180K to $250K$250K to $350K
New York$170K to $240K$230K to $330K
Seattle$170K to $240K$230K to $320K
Austin$150K to $210K$200K to $280K
Boston$160K to $220K$220K to $300K
Remote (US)$150K to $230K$200K to $300K

International

LocationMid-Level BaseSenior Base
LondonGBP 60K to 90KGBP 90K to 140K
BerlinEUR 55K to 80KEUR 80K to 120K
TorontoCAD 100K to 150KCAD 150K to 220K
BangaloreINR 15L to 30LINR 30L to 60L
ZurichCHF 100K to 140KCHF 140K to 200K

Salary by Specialization

Some AI specializations command significant salary premiums:

LLM Engineering: 15% to 25% premium over general ML engineering. The surge in demand for LLM specialists since 2023 has driven salaries well above market averages.

ML Infrastructure/Platform: 10% to 20% premium. Building scalable ML systems requires rare combined expertise in systems engineering and ML.

AI Safety/Alignment: 15% to 30% premium at frontier labs. The growing focus on AI safety has created intense competition for researchers in this area.

Robotics/Embodied AI: 10% to 15% premium. Hardware-software integration skills are scarce and valuable.

Computer Vision: Market rate to 10% premium. Demand varies by application domain, with autonomous vehicles and medical imaging offering the most.

Total Compensation Breakdown

AI engineer compensation at top companies typically breaks down as follows:

Base salary: 40% to 60% of total compensation

Equity/RSUs: 25% to 45% of total compensation

Annual bonus: 10% to 20% of base salary

Signing bonus: $20K to $100K (one-time)

At senior levels and above, equity becomes the dominant component. A senior ML engineer at a pre-IPO AI startup might have a base of $200K but equity worth $200K to $400K+ per year at projected valuations.

How to Negotiate Your AI Salary

Know your market rate. Use Levels.fyi, Glassdoor, and industry surveys to benchmark. AI roles often pay 20% to 40% more than equivalent software engineering positions.

Negotiate the full package. Base salary is often the hardest to move. Focus on equity, signing bonus, and level. Getting leveled one step higher can mean $50K to $100K+ more per year.

Get competing offers. The most effective negotiation leverage is a competing offer. Even if you prefer one company, having alternatives gives you bargaining power.

Highlight specialized skills. If you have expertise in high-demand areas like LLMs, distributed training, or ML infrastructure, make sure to emphasize this during negotiations.
